Co-simulation on Automatic Pouring of Truck-mounted Concrete Boom Pump

摘要

A concept of automatic concrete pouring of truck-mounted concrete boom pump was presented and discussed. Then the concrete pouring process and the kinematics of the boom sections were analyzed, including the inverse kinematics problem. Transient dynamic analysis was performed to validate the impact of new control system on the boom base on the flexible body co-simulation between ANSYS and ADAMS. A 3D simulation was programmed to imitate the process of automatic pouring and verify the control algorithm. The simulation result shows that the system can pour concrete on a long narrow field automatically, and the boom''s movement is smooth.
